An Overview of the Experience

This day trip from Tirana or Durrës is designed for those who want to see some of Albania’s most striking natural sites without the hassle of planning multiple excursions. Starting early at 6:00 am from a centrally located meeting point, your day begins with a scenic drive towards the Koman Lake area. This journey, lasting about 3.5 hours, takes you through Albania’s lush landscapes, giving a glimpse of the rural life and mountainous terrain that define this country’s unspoiled charm.

Once you arrive at Koman, you’ll board a boat for approximately an hour, gliding across the calm, expansive waters of Komani Lake. The views here are often called mesmerizing—vast, tranquil, and framed by towering mountains. Many travelers describe this part of the trip as a highlight, with one reviewer calling the guide “great” and praising the scenic boat ride for its “beautiful views.” This part of the tour sets a peaceful, almost meditative tone for the day.

The Jewel: Shala River

After the boat ride, you’ll reach Shala River, also known as the “Thailand of Albania,” thanks to its lush surroundings and turquoise waters. Here, you’ll have ample free time—about five hours—to relax among nature. The guide stays with you throughout, offering suggestions, but you’re free to swim, sunbathe, or explore. As one happy traveler noted, they enjoyed “basking in the sun’s warmth” and swimming in the refreshing waters. Many find this segment ideal for unwinding and soaking in the pristine environment, a true highlight of the trip.

Lunchtime offers a chance to enjoy a included meal, allowing you to recharge before heading back on the boat and starting the return journey. The scenery during this part of the trip is just as captivating, with rugged mountains and crystal-clear waters providing the perfect backdrop for photos and quiet reflection.

The Return Journey

After a final stop for coffee—an appreciated break for many—your group departs for Tirana. The drive back takes about four hours, giving you time to process the day’s sights or chat about the highlights. The tour ends at the same meeting point where it started, making logistics straightforward and hassle-free.
